The scale. It can be indicated by a scale bar and/or a ratio 1:n. The number n is called scale denominator. This enables the map user to measure a distance on the map and determine the distance on the ground.

State space search in artificial intelligence refers to the systematic exploration of all possible states and transitions within a problem to find a solution. It involves navigating through a problem's state space, which represents the set of all possible states, using various search algorithms such as breadth-first search, depth-first search, uniform cost search, and A* search. The goal is to find an optimal or satisfactory solution by evaluating different paths and transitions in the state space.
